仓酷云

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 1591|回复: 19
打印 上一主题 下一主题

[学习教程] ASP网页编程之ASP.NET页面中显示数据库纪录集最快的方...

[复制链接]
分手快乐 该用户已被删除
跳转到指定楼层
楼主
发表于 2015-2-3 23:37:57 | 显示全部楼层 回帖奖励 |倒序浏览 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
无法实现跨操作系统的应用。当然这也是微软的理由之一,只有这样才能发挥ASP最佳的能力。可是我却认为正是Windows限制了ASP,ASP的概念本就是为一个能让系统运行于一个大的多样化环境而设计的;asp.net|纪录集|数据|数据库|显示|页面   小鸡弓手在DataGrid的利用理论中提到过DataGrid的功能成绩,现看到了微软DEV411 ASP.NET:Best Practices For Performance中有量化数据,摘录之。

均匀而言:
- DataReader比DataSet快16%
- SQLDataReader比OleDbDataReader快115%
- 下标援用比字段名援用快11%
- 巨细写婚配的字段名比巨细写不婚配的字段名的快1%
- 直接写script比DataGrid快223%
- 不必ViewState比用ViewState快66%
- 不必模板列比用模板列快39%
- 显式类型转换比用DataBinding快11%
- 利用数据缓存比尺度DataGrid快667%
- 利用Output缓存比尺度DataGrid要无穷地快

结论已很清晰了,就不翻译了,:-)
</p>  源代码保护方面其实现在考虑得没那么多了..NET也可以反编译.ASP写得复杂的话别人能看得懂的话.他也有能力自己写了.这方面担心的倒不太多. 纵观现在网上可以下载的那些所谓BBS还有什么网站等等的源代码
分手快乐 该用户已被删除
沙发
 楼主| 发表于 2015-3-26 06:11:15 | 显示全部楼层
哪些内置对象是可以跳过的,或者哪些属性和方法是用不到的?
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|仓酷云 鄂ICP备14007578号-2

GMT+8, 2024-5-28 13:06

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表